Lenny Bruce was an American stand-up comedian, social critic, and satirist who gained notoriety for his controversial and provocative style of comedy. Known for his fearless approach to discussing taboo topics, Bruce pushed the boundaries of free speech and challenged societal norms. His quotes continue to resonate today, offering insights into the human condition, politics, religion, and censorship.

Read these Lenny Bruce Quotes

“In the halls of justice, the only justice is in the halls.”

“Satire is tragedy plus time. You give it enough time, the public, the reviewers will allow you to satirize it. Which is rather ridiculous, when you think about it.”

“Every day people are straying away from the church and going back to God.”

“The only honest art form is laughter, comedy. You can’t fake it… try to fake three laughs in an hour – ha ha ha ha ha – they’ll take you away, man. You can’t.”

“The liberals can understand everything but people who don’t understand them.”

“The role of a comedian is to make the audience laugh, at a minimum of once every fifteen seconds.”

“I won’t say ours was a tough school, but we had our own coroner. We used to write essays like: What I’m going to be if I grow up.”

“If you can’t say ‘fuck,’ you can’t say, ‘fuck the government’.”
